Ironically, the only other foreign country I've been in is Costa Rica! As far as what to take? Take anything that's American made that you really want/need. For example, I recall that at the local bakery, beautiful loaves of bread (made locally in Costa Rica) cost about 40 cents (as opposed to $4 in the US). However, when one of my friend's point and shoot camera broke, she went to buy a disposable one. $28 in Costa Rica! So anything that they have to import into the country will cost you moocho. Stuff that they make there is dirt cheap.
